Vicar
Location: Ketton and Tinwell
East Midlands
Recruiter: Peterborough Diocese
Ref: JN013471
This is an exciting time to be joining Peterborough Diocese and the Ketton and Tinwell parishes. Under the leadership of Bishop Debbie Sellin, the diocese is praying, dreaming, consulting and planning about the way ahead for our mission and ministry. There are plenty of challenges but also many wonderful blessings and opportunities. God is good and we are confident that our future is in his hands.
We are looking for an exciting opportunity to buck the trend in declining rural parishes? Work with our lay team to continue to grow and revitalize our two churches. Our vision to see the kingdom of God expand in our beautiful rural community where each parish church is a focus of village life. Could God be calling you?
We are looking for a person who:
- Has a heart for serving and growing the Kingdom of God in a rural community where each parish church is a focus on village life.
- Is grounded in faith and the word of God and is confident to proclaim the gospel to all, irrespective of age or tradition.
- Is friendly and approachable who can meet people where they are.
- Is a good listener, prayerful and considerate; A good sense of humour wouldn't go amiss.
- Is sympathetic to; and embraces varying styles of worship from the traditional to a more relaxed style of family service.
- Is enthusiastic to see growth both in number but also in faith, to pursue outreach opportunities particularly with families and young people.
- Has a heart for engaging with our village CE School and the many opportunities for outreach that provides.
- Is keen to work collaboratively to build on the strong relationships we have via our 'churches together' links to serve our communities.
- Is an enabler who is able to lead by example and encourage others to use their gifts and grow in faith.
- Has the gift of preaching and communicating the gospel to people at different stages of their faith journey.
- Comes with experience of developing ministries and growing congregations.
- Has experience working with children and youth groups.
